Cast light weight aluminum alloys are made by melting pure aluminum and combining it with other steels while in fluid type. The mix is poured into a sand, pass away, or financial investment mold.

There are several minor distinctions between functioned and cast aluminum alloys, such as that actors alloys can have extra substantial quantities of various other steels than wrought alloys. The most notable distinction in between these alloys is the construction process via which they will go to deliver the final product. Besides some surface area therapies, cast alloys will certainly leave their mold in nearly the specific strong kind wanted, whereas functioned alloys will certainly undertake numerous alterations while in their strong state

Various components call for various production methods to cast light weight aluminum, such as sand casting or pass away casting.
Die spreading is the name given to the process of creating complicated steel elements through usage of molds of the element, also recognized as passes away. It produces even more components than any kind of various other procedure, with a high degree of accuracy and repeatability. There are three sub-processes that fall under the group of die casting: gravity die spreading (or irreversible mold and mildew casting), low-pressure die casting and high-pressure die casting.

The pure steel, additionally understood as ingot, is included in the heating system and maintained the molten temperature of the steel, which is after that transferred to the shot chamber and injected into the die. The pressure is after that maintained as the metal strengthens. As soon as the metal solidifies, the cooling procedure begins.
The thicker the wall surface of the part, the longer the cooling time due to the amount of indoor metal that additionally needs to cool. After the part is completely cooled down, the die cuts in half open and an ejection mechanism pushes the part out. Complying with the ejection, the die is shut for the next shot cycle.

To obtain to the finished item, there are three primary alloys made use of as die casting product to select from: zinc, aluminum and magnesium.
Zinc is one of the most used alloys for die casting due to its lower price of raw materials. Its rust resistance additionally allows the elements to be lengthy enduring, and it is one of the more castable alloys due to its reduced melting point.
